轻松实现ASA数据库转MySQL的方法(asa数据库转mysql)

轻松实现ASA数据库转MySQL的方法

ASA数据库(Adaptive Server Anywhere)是一种轻量级的关系型数据库管理系统,常用于嵌入式系统和移动设备上。然而,在实际应用中,由于历史原因或技术要求等因素,需要将ASA数据库转换为MySQL数据库。本文将介绍一种简单易用的ASA数据库转MySQL的方法。

步骤一:安装ASA数据库和MySQL数据库

首先需要下载安装ASA数据库和MySQL数据库,这里不再赘述其具体安装方法。在安装过程中,需要注意选择合适的版本和配置参数,以满足实际需求。

步骤二:导出ASA数据库

打开ASA数据库管理工具,选择要导出的数据库,右键单击该数据库,选择“Unload Database”选项。在弹出的对话框中,选择要导出的表、独立存储过程、触发器和视图等对象,并指定导出文件的保存路径和文件名。点击“确定”按钮,开始导出ASA数据库。

示例代码:

UNLOAD DATABASE FILE 'D:\ASA_DB\mydb.db' 
CREATE FILE 'D:\ASA_DB\mydb.sql' FORMAT TEXT;
SELECT * FROM mytable;
SELECT * FROM myview;
SELECT * FROM myprocedure;
SELECT * FROM mytrigger;
OUTPUT TO 'D:\ASA_DB\mydb.sql';

步骤三:导入MySQL数据库

打开MySQL数据库管理工具,选择要导入的数据库,右键单击该数据库,选择“Open SQL Script”选项。在弹出的对话框中,选择要导入的文件,即上一步导出的ASA数据库文件。点击“确定”按钮,开始导入MySQL数据库。

示例代码:

USE mydb;
SOURCE 'D:\ASA_DB\mydb.sql';

步骤四:验证数据转换结果

经过以上操作,ASA数据库的数据已经成功转换为MySQL数据库的数据,可以通过在MySQL数据库中执行SQL语句来验证转换结果。

示例代码:

USE mydb;
SELECT * FROM mytable;
SELECT * FROM myview;
SHOW PROCEDURE STATUS WHERE Db = 'mydb';
SHOW TRIGGERS FROM mydb;

总结:

本文介绍了一种简单易用的ASA数据库转MySQL的方法,通过导出ASA数据库文件和导入MySQL数据库文件的操作,实现了轻松地将ASA数据库转换为MySQL数据库。同时,本文也提供了相应的示例代码,方便读者进行操作实践。


数据运维技术 » 轻松实现ASA数据库转MySQL的方法(asa数据库转mysql)